If the nightly backfill scheduler on Driftwell stalls, first check whether the lock file in the coordinator pod went stale — that's the culprit nine times out of ten. Clear it, bump the run, and watch the first three partitions land before walking away. Don't restart the whole fleet; that just queues duplicate jobs. If it still hangs, grab the token below and page the Driftwell data crew with it.

session token of bawep-yadup = htk21_528abd376e3c5a4ec24a1

Wiki: Divestiture of the Marrow Instruments Unit (Managers Only)

This page summarises the planned sale of the Marrow Instruments unit to Velsholt Group, prepared for the incoming director. Diligence materials are held by the Tannery Row office; staff consultations conclude this month. Pricing, earn-out terms, and transition-services scope remain under negotiation and must not be discussed outside this group. Timelines may shift pending regulatory review in Ostrevane. The strategic rationale and forward plan are noted below.

management briefing: The pricing group signed off on a budget of $378.8 million for Project Kasael.

## Authentication

FormulaDock evaluates user-supplied formulas inside the Quarrel sandbox, so no expression can touch the host filesystem or network. Before the sandbox accepts jobs, your worker must authenticate against the Quarrel gateway on every boot. Please treat this credential as production-sensitive even in staging. Use the key below when registering your worker.

gateway credential: kto23_LX9A4ys6i4nzHtpOLNLodKK

Subject: Payroll export ownership change

Hi — as part of the Quillmark payroll export moving from fixed-width to the new columnar format, ownership of the export validation step is shifting teams effective next sprint. Release notes, rollback criteria, and the cutover checklist remain unchanged. Going forward, please direct all sign-off requests for this format to the person listed below.

approver of yahif-hahif = Wenwyn Eliael